Franco Debono contemplating new political party
Nationalist MP Franco Debono has revealed that in the coming days he will announce whether or not he will contest the general election under the banner of a new party.
Asked details about the possibility of contesting the coming elections by forming a party, Dr Debono replied, “I said what I wanted to say in my blog”. Franco Debono published in his blog post yesterday that he is considering contesting the election under a new party, possibly called 'the People’s Party’, but will reach a clear and final decision in the coming days.
“I had made all necessary preparations to go and chase my dream to work in Italy, but following a debate on local media, the people reached out to me in such a strong way that I had to change plans,” Dr Debono told di-ve.com.
In a comment Dr Debono gave to di-ve.com this morning, he said that in his life he had three dreams. To be a criminal defence lawyer, to be a Member of Parliament and to work in Italy. “The first two I have already achieved, although in each case I had to start from scratch. Nothing came easy, but I always made an effort to make my dreams a reality,” Dr Debono said.
The MP explained that people have had enough of the arrogance the country is governed with, including cases of TV presenters with a clear bias on public television. “Peppi Azzopardi is the person who advised Lawrence Gonzi in difficult times. He was also one of the people involved in a reconciliation attempt between myself and the PN. The bias of such individuals is clearly known,” Dr Debono added.
